Re: RenPy HotSpot Tool
It might just be me or how I'm using it or my computer but it actually seems like none of the points actually transfer to my game correctly. As if they're 100 points off or something all ways lol It's fine though, it gets me closer than with nothing at all but I just started resorting to putting a temporary textbutton on the screen and positioning it where I want the hotspot then put those numbers on the hotspot
